10:50 The Full Access UTV fuel rail made no noticeable changes on my KRX. I did have to take out the grub screw and put thread tape on it. Full Access failed to put anything on the threads and it leaked like a sieve. Their rollover valve cured the hard starting issues, but now you can smell fumes inside the cab.
Full Access’s fuel rail is a crappy design compared to other aftermarket options.
